Output 59cfdd7e8f17c632f4f243edf95a990a7c9f53ada060018935494d7702730f38:1

value
419985310
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 680e69b69cf2dea33f6b7fef78bc27fc00eeaf4e OP_EQUALVERIFY OP_CHECKSIG
address
1AVCYNzZNN9AyqgxxcBc7VMeuWMLvbELum
transaction
59cfdd7e8f17c632f4f243edf95a990a7c9f53ada060018935494d7702730f38
confirmations
475229
spent
true